Linux入门命令
pwd:查看当前目录位置
cd: 改变目录。 cd / 切换到根目录,cd .. 回到上一级
ls:查看当前目录下的文件。ls -l查看文件详细信息,ls -lh显示文件详细信息(人性化地展示文件,具体文件大小),ls -a显示隐藏文件
vim:在当前目录创建文件,按i进入编辑模式;先按esc,再按shift+:,再输入wq,以保存文件且退出
cat:查看文件内容
more:查看文件内容,显示阅读到文件的百分之多少
mkdir:在当前目录创建文件夹,mkdir -p a/b/c
mv:移动文件或目录。mkdir -p China/Shanxi/Taiyuan/Wanbailin递归创建目录
tree:查看目录结构,tree China, yum -y install tree
man help:线上查询及帮助命令
cp:拷贝
find:查找, find / -name "*.log",find /var/log -name "app.log",find / -size +10000000,find / -size +90M | xargs ls -lh
mv:剪切
rm:删除(尽量少用,不可恢复),rm -r
>data:清空文件内容
touch:创建一个空文件
kill:结束进程,kill -9强行停掉进程
tar:打包文件,tar acvf demo.tar.gz ./*(将当前文件夹下所有文件打包)
df -h:当前磁盘使用情况
du -sh:当前文件夹的大小
free -m:查看内存情况
top:显示程序消耗的CPU、内存
ip a:查看机器ip地址
chmod:改变用户组,chmod user.user directory/,chmod 755 directory